Automated Method for Uterine Contraction Extraction and Classification of Term Versus Pre-Term EHG Signals

Rubana Hoque Chowdhury,
Quazi Delwar Hossain,
Mohiuddin Ahmad

Abstract: The significance of uterine contractions in facilitating the successful birth of fetuses is selfevident. Timely recognition of high-risk deliveries, coupled with the administration of appropriate medication, has emerged as a promising approach to address this concern. However, the quest for effective early diagnostic methods continues to present a challenge in the field.
